On Thu, May 18, 2017 at 05:38:56PM +0300, Mika Westerberg wrote:
> Thunderbolt fabric consists of one or more switches. This fabric is
> called domain and it is controlled by an entity called connection
> manager. The connection manager can be either internal (driven by a
> firmware running on the host controller) or external (software driver).
> This driver currently implements support for the latter.
> 
> In order to manage switches and their properties more easily we model
> this domain structure as a Linux bus. Each host controller adds a domain
> device to this bus, and these devices are named as domainN where N
> stands for index or id of the current domain.
> 
> We then abstract connection manager specific operations into a new
> structure tb_cm_ops and convert the existing tb.c to fill those
> accordingly. This makes it easier to add support for the internal
> connection manager in subsequent patches.

> +static DEFINE_IDA(tb_domain_ida);

You forgot to clean this up in your module exit code with a call to
ida_destroy(&tb_domain_ida);

Yeah, it's not obvious, I've made the same mistake before :)

Other than that minor thing, the bus logic looks good, nice job.
